Hardware Requirements

ESP32

N20 DC geared motors with Encoders X2

18650 Cells X2

Jumper Wires , 5mm nuts and screws

Motor driver ( Mini L298N)

Solder , Soldering Wires , Soldering Paste , Soldering jumper wires

N20 motor wheels X2

N20 mini Car Caster Wheel X1

Slider Button

Mini 360 Buck converter to 5V

Battery Charger Circuit

Software Requirements

Ubuntu 22.04

ROS2 humble
